Embossed Christmas tree

Hello friends,
There is a month of holiday cards challenge at Beccy's Place, and I just don't seem to be able to get as many done as I have in the past, but I have made one with  the theme for yesterday... ...Christmas trees.

This was a really quick card to make, almost felt like I was cheating.

I had a red card already folded. Took a piece of white pearly cardstock and embossed the tree with a Cuttlebug folder

Next step was to decorate it. I used some gems, Pontura pearl makers, glitter and with Pan Pastels, added a touch of colour to some flowers, leaves and the base.

Added a peel-off sentiment.
